reservoir
Pronunciation
/ˈrɛzərˌvwɑr/
/ˈrɛzəvwɑː/

Reservoir
01

tĂĄrozĂł, vĂ­ztĂĄrolĂł

a lake, either natural or artificial, from which water is supplied to houses

02

any organism or substance in which an infectious agent normally lives and multiplies

04

a supply of something intangible that can be drawn on when needed

Példåk
He drew from a reservoir of experience during the negotiation.
